Software Development Engineer, AWS Vulnerability Management (AVM)

Global technology company leading in e-commerce, cloud computing, and artificial intelligence
$129,300 - $223,600
Security
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Cybersecurity · Enterprise SaaS

Description For Software Development Engineer, AWS Vulnerability Management (AVM)

At Amazon's AWS Security division, we're seeking a Software Development Engineer to join our Vulnerability Management (AVM) team. This role sits at the intersection of security and scalable software development, where you'll be instrumental in building and maintaining tools that protect Amazon's vast digital infrastructure.

Our team is responsible for creating and maintaining security tooling and processes that help identify and track potential security risks across Amazon's global operations. We work with cutting-edge technologies and embrace a culture of continuous learning and innovation.

As an SDE in the AVM team, you'll collaborate with a diverse group of professionals, including Software Development Engineers, Security Engineers, and System Development Engineers. You'll be working on solutions that directly impact the security posture of one of the world's largest technology companies. The role offers exposure to various AWS services and the opportunity to build highly scalable security solutions.

The position offers competitive compensation ranging from $129,300 to $223,600 based on location and experience, plus additional benefits. You'll be part of a team that values work-life harmony, offering flexible work arrangements and strong support for professional growth.

This is an excellent opportunity for engineers who are passionate about security, enjoy solving complex problems at scale, and want to work with a team that embraces diversity and continuous learning. You'll be contributing to critical security infrastructure while working alongside some of the industry's best talents in either Seattle, WA or Austin, TX.

Last updated 7 days ago

Responsibilities For Software Development Engineer, AWS Vulnerability Management (AVM)

  • Designing and building services that scale for millions of users and systems
  • Driving new innovation in the Amazon/AWS ecosystem
  • Working with different technologies and architectures
  • Solving complex problems across teams and organizations
  • Owning solutions from roadmap to implementation and continuous development
  • Maintaining highly scalable solutions built on AWS Services
  • Working with compliance and application security teams
  • Identifying and tracking security exposures worldwide

Requirements For Software Development Engineer, AWS Vulnerability Management (AVM)

Java
Python
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language
  • Experience with design patterns, reliability and scaling of new and existing systems

Benefits For Software Development Engineer, AWS Vulnerability Management (AVM)

Medical Insurance
  • Medical, financial, and other benefits
  • Flexible work hours
  • Career development and training opportunities
  • Diverse and inclusive workplace
  • Continuous learning opportunities

Interested in this job?

Jobs Related To Amazon Software Development Engineer, AWS Vulnerability Management (AVM)

Software Developer Engineer II, ACTI

Software Engineer II position at Amazon's Security Threat Intelligence team, focusing on security automation and data pipeline development.

Software Dev Engineer II, CS Security

Software Development Engineer position focusing on building security automation tools and frameworks for Amazon's Customer Service Application Security team.

Security Engineer, GuardDuty Security Analytics and AI Research

Security Engineer role at AWS focusing on AI/ML-driven security analytics for GuardDuty, requiring 3+ years of programming experience and security expertise.

Software Dev Engineer II, CS Security

Software Development Engineer role focusing on building security automation solutions and reusable libraries for Amazon's Customer Service team.

System Development Engineer, AWS Security, Software Engineering, AWS Security Operations Centre (SOC)

System Development Engineer role at Amazon's AWS Security Operations Centre, focusing on building and maintaining secure, scalable software systems.